Default GP Extra 300SP unstable in roll

Evening guys,

I am looking for some input into what I feel is an issue. The aircraft is trimmed and cg is in the recommended range. When I fly the aircraft it does not really want to stay wings level. Its almost like its balancing on a ball always wanting to tip to one side. I make an input back to wings level and shortly thereafter, it falls off the other way. If I was building it I would say it needs a bit of dihedral. Obviously I can not put any in.

Does anyone have any recommendations? Reflex both ailerons?

Check that the plane is balanced laterally. Also check that the aileron distance at the fuselage are equal, if .25 in down on one side, it should be .25 in up on the other.
